HERBIVORE

Herbivore are animals that eat mainly plants including leaves, grass, flowers, seeds, fruits, bark, and pollen. Some herbivores are cows, deer, horses, rabbits, bees, sheep, and grasshoppers.

OMNIVORES

Omnivores are animals that are able to eat plants and animals. Some omnivores are humans, raccoons, most bears, apes and monkeys, seagulls and other birds.

CARNIVORES

Carnivores are animals that eat mainly meat. This includes insects and all animals. Some carnivores are lions, tigers and all cats, eagles, hawks, owls, sharks, frogs, and spiders.
